Description

A typical mobile phone keypad looks like this:

To type an English letter, you need to press a number key multiple times. For example, to type x\tt x, you need to press 99 twice: the first press outputs w\tt w, and the second turns w\tt w into x\tt x. Pressing the 00 key once outputs a space.

Your task is to read a sentence that contains only lowercase English letters and spaces, and find the minimum number of key presses required to type this sentence on the phone.

Input Format

One line containing a sentence that consists of lowercase English letters and spaces, with length at most 200 characters.

Output Format

One line with one integer, the total number of key presses.

i have a dream
23
